reallocate (v)

allocate, distribute, or apportion anew

The company had to reallocate its resources to focus on the most urgent projects.

The school decided to reallocate funds from athletics to academics.

The government announced plans to reallocate tax revenue to healthcare and education.

The organization had to reallocate staff to handle the increased demand for services.
